WebFeb 14, 2024 · Horseradish is propagated through crowns or pencil-sized root cuttings, which are sometimes called “sets.” Utah State recommends you cut the thicker end square and the other end on an angle. WebBefore planting horseradish, spade or rototill the soil to a depth of 8 to 10 inches. Plant root cuttings, sometimes called "sets," in early spring as soon as the soil is workable. Weed control is especially important early in the season when the plants are relatively small. To grow high-quality horseradish, lift and strip the roots twice.
